Lizhen Asked: 2017-11-06 19:49:06 +0800 CST2017-11-06 19:49:06 +0800 CST 2017-11-06 19:49:06 +0800 CST MongoDB WiredTiger 错误:collection-*.wt 似乎不是 WiredTiger 文件 (Window10) 772 mongoDB 版本:3.4.2 操作系统:win10 问题:由于 .wt 文件损坏而无法启动 mongoDB 重置 mongoDB 数据库路径时,cmd 给出如图所示的错误任何提示将不胜感激,谢谢 mongodb wiredtiger 1 个回答 Voted Best Answer Md Haidar Ali Khan 2017-11-06T21:55:13+08:002017-11-06T21:55:13+08:00 @Lizhen,可能是 Wiredtiger 不干净的关机。只需转到 'E:\Work_App\MongoDB\bin' 并输入命令提示符,如 然后在命令提示符下运行查询“mongod --dbpath /data/db –repair” 假设我已经安装了MongoDB,C:\Program Files\MongoDB\Server\3.2\bin那么查询语句将是这样的 C:\Program Files\MongoDB\Server\3.2\bin>mongod --dbpath /data/db --repair 正如您已经说过的,您的 MongoDB 安装路径是E:\Work_App_MongoDB\bin. 所以在你的地方它会是 E:\Work_App_MongoDB\bin>mongod --dbpath /data/db –repair 希望对您有所帮助。
@Lizhen,可能是 Wiredtiger 不干净的关机。只需转到 'E:\Work_App\MongoDB\bin' 并输入命令提示符,如
然后在命令提示符下运行查询
“mongod --dbpath /data/db –repair”
假设我已经安装了MongoDB,
C:\Program Files\MongoDB\Server\3.2\bin
那么查询语句将是这样的正如您已经说过的,您的 MongoDB 安装路径是
E:\Work_App_MongoDB\bin
. 所以在你的地方它会是希望对您有所帮助。